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 80 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
80
Dung lượng
2,44 MB
Nội dung
80 GIAO DUC VA aA.o TAO TRU'ONG D~l HQC KINH TE TP.HO CHi MINH 000 DE TAl NGHIEN ClJ'U KHOA HOC • CAPTRU'O'NG £>E lrNG DUNGCONGNGHETHONGTINQUANLY I>E TAl NGHIEN ClrU cAcCAP I>AO TAO (Clr NHAN, TH~C Si, TIEN Si) MA 80:2001-028 NGU'O'I THU'C HIEN: PGS.TS LE THANH HA TS PH~M XUAN LAN CN NGUYEN TAN AN TP HO CHi MINH 2002 DJ tainghien czm khoa hQc Truang D(li hQc Kinh d TP.HCM 2002 Liri cam un Chfulg toi xin chan thrum cam on: •!• Phong quanlydao tl;lo •!• Khoa qufm tri kinh doanh •!• Khoa dao tl;lo tl;li chuc •!• Phong quanly khoa hQc f>a tl;lO ffiQl di~u ki~n Vel giup chung toi hoan d~ tai Qmin ly d~ tai t6t nghi~p Trang I Dd tainghien ctlu khoa h9c Truc!ng Dgi h9c Kinh t€ TP.HCM 2002 Mucluc • • ,, ,, ;t~ L (Jl noz uau I MlJC TIEU BE TAI: • " y'rr r II NOI DUNGNGHIEN Cuu: Phful I: THVC TMNG CONG TAC QUAN L YBE TAl TOT NGHIEP cAccAP BAO TAO NGANH TAl KHOA QUAN TRl KINH DOANH 10 I GIOI THI:SU vE KHOA QUAN TRl KINH DOANH: 10 Nhan s\1': 1o Cac b{> mon tf\IC thu{>c khoa: 10 Cac mon hc;>c khoa phv tnich b~c cir nhan: 11 II THVC TMNG CONG TAC QUAN L YBE TAI TOT NGHIEP cAccAP BAO TAO NGANH QUAN TRl KINH DOANH: 12 Quanly chung: 12 Quanly dang kY d~ 1iti tf>t nghi~p: 12 Quanly sau hoan thanh: 13 Nh~ xet: 15 Phful II: :xAy Dl)NG BETAI 18 Y:Eu cAu BE TAI: 18 " t'ac nh"~p th"ong t"m va' quan • 1,y th"ong t"m: 19 V ~ cong 1.1 Nh~p thong tin: 19 1.2 Quanlythong tin: 20 v"e cong " t,ac phvc V\1 ngucrt• · d'ung: 21 Quim ly d€ tai t6t nghi~p Trang2 Truong Dt;~i h9c Kinh fi TP.HCM 2002 EJJ tainghien cUll khoa hoc V~ bfw m~t (security) an toan h~ th6ng: 22 II GIOI THn;u PHAN MEM, NGON NGU TmJC HII;N DE TAL 25 H~ di~u hanh (Operator system): Windows 200 Server Professional v6i liS 5.0 25 HTTP, HTM:L 26 2.1 HTTP (Hypertext Tranfer Protocol): 26 2.2 HTM:L (Hyper Text Market Language): 27 Ca sa du li~u (Database Server): SQL Server 7.0: 28 Stored Procedure: 31 Open database connectivity (ODBC): 32 Cong C\l (Tools): ASP, VBScript, JavaScript 34 6.1 ASP (Microsoft Active Server Page): 34 6.2 VBScript (Visual Basic Script): 35 6.3 JavaScript: 36 Microsoft Visual InterDev 6.0: 37 III MO HiNH QUAN HE DULlED: 38 Mo hinh quan h~ du li~u: Tir di~n du li~u: 39 IV THIET KE WEBSITE, VIET CHUONG TRiNH DIEU KHIEN: 41 Ky thu~t truy xuAt du li~u: 41 Phong chu dung tren toan b() chuang trinh: 43 PhAn Web site ph\lc V\1 nguoi su dl,lng: 43 Trang tra c1lu thongtin d6 tai: 44 3.2 Trang hi~n thi k~t qua tra c1lu: 45 3.4 Trang th6ng ke tren (rng d1,mg: 46 Qmin ly d~ tai t6t nghi~p Trang D~ tainghien czm khoa h(Jc Truong Dt;~i h9c Kinh d TP.HCM 2002 3.4 Trang tim ki~m: 47 3.5 Trang ti~n ich: 47 Phk quanly (rng dl)ng: 49 4.1 Cac trang nh~p thong tin: 50 4.2 Trang hien thi thong tin, c~p nh~t, x6a: 56 4.3 Trang tim ki~m thongtin lu~ an: 67 4.4 Upload file: 67 Phfut III: TRIEN KHAI UNG Dl)NG & HI$U QUA KINH TE 72 I TRIEN KHAI UNG Dl)NG: 72 D\1' Tru kinh phi: 72 1.1 Kinh phi mua s~m thi~t bt may moe 72 1.2 Kinh phi dao t~o sir dl)ng 72 Nhan h,rc: 73 TA chuc quan ly: 73 II HI$U QUA: 74 Phdn IV: KET LUAN & KIEN NGHJ 76 I KET LUAN: 76 Vu diem: 76 H~ ch~: 77 , h, A Huang p at trten: 77 II KIEN NGHJ: 78 Tcli li~u tham khao 79 Quan Iy d~ tai t6t nghi~p Trang4 DJ tainghien cU"U khoa h9c Truang Dt;zi h9c Kinh ti TP.HCM 2002 ' Lili noi ilau The k)' 20 da di qua de l~i nhihlg tvu vi d~i rna nguai da d~t dugc linh vvc phat trien cong ngh~, t~o cac nganh nghe kinh doanh m6i, va nang cao muc sBng cua nguai M()t tuong lai tuai sang thai d~i cua nen kinh te thong tin, toan cau h6a va thuong m~i di~n tir V6i m\}c tieu "xa h()i h6a thong tin", Vi~t Nam da chinh thuc gia nh~p h~ thBng m~g Internet the gi6i vao 19/1111997 nh&m t~o da phat trien kinh te cho dfit nu6c cling nhu giam b6t khoang each ve cong ngh~ thongtin VOi cac nUOC khac khu V\fC va tren the gi6i Truang B~i hQc Kinh te TP.HCM hi~n la m()t 10 truang d~i hQC trQng diem quBc gia, la IDQt trung tam dao t~O Va nghien Clru khoa hQC kinh te c6 uy tin ca nu6c nai dao t~o nhan h.rc, b6i du5ng nhan tai ph\lC V\1 cho tien trinh cong nghi~p h6a Va hi~n d~i h6a dfit nUOC, the h()i nh~p kinh te toan cau XU Nhihlg nam gan day v6i chu truong dfiy m~ cong ngh~ thongtin ap d\lllg vao cong tac quanly va dao t~o, nha truang da dau tu va xay dvng nhieu cong trinh, dv an ve cong ngh~ thongtin nhu trang bi may vi tinh, xay dvng cac h~ thBng m~ng Intranet ket n6i Internet trvc tuyen, h~ thBng quanly thu vi~n tren m~ng, h~ thBng m~g ph\lc V\1 cong tac tuyen sinh, quanlytai chfnh nhieu detainghien Clru khoa hQC da dugc th\fC hi~n nh&m nang cao hon nfra chAt luQllg quanly va dao t~o cua nha truang Hi~n nay, s6 luQllg sinh vien h~ d~i hQc va cao dfuJg chinh quy, hoan chinh d~i hQc, cu nhan van b&ng 2- chinh quy, t~i chuc hi~n dang dugc Qmin ly d~ t!li t6t nghi~p Trang EJ€ tainghien ctlu khoa hQc Trucmg fJ(li hQc Kinh ti TP.HCM 2002 dflO t~o t~i nha tru(mg len den han 40.000 sinh vien SB lUQ'llg sinh vien tBt nghi~p hang nam cua cac h~ ciing tren 4.000 sinh vien Vi~c quanlydetai t6t nghi~p cac d.p dao t~o hi~n vful dugc thvc hi~n chu yeu tren gidy I>ieu khien cho m()t s6 cacdetai t6t nghi~p cling nam trimg l~p dang Icy giao vien hu6ng dfin khac nhau, ho~c nganh khac Th~m chi tinh tr~g gian 1~, chep detaicac nam tru6c ciing rAt kh6 phat hi~n Nh~m kh~c phl;lC tinh hinh neu tren va nang cao han nua chdt luQ'llg dao t~o, d~c bi~t la khau quanlydetai t6t nghi~p khoa Quan tri kinh doanh da chu d()ng thvc hi~n detainghien cful khoa hQc: "Ung dvng cong ngh~ thongtin d6 quful lydetainghien c(m cac cdp dao t~o (cu nhan, th~c si, tien si)" theo dung chu truang tin hQc h6a quanlydao t~o cua nha truoog Qmin ly dB tai t6t nghi~p Trang Truong Dqi h9c Kinh ti TP.HCM 2002 D~ tili nghien czrn khoa h9c I MVC TlEU DE TAI: Vi~c Ung d\mg cong ngh~ thongtinde qmin ly d~ tainghienCUucaccApdao t~o nhfun d~t cac ml,lc tieu sau day: I>Ay m~ tin hc hoa cong tac quanly theo doog chu truong cua nha tru(mg d~ Phl,lC Vl) cong tac luu trfr, tra CUu va tim kiem thongtin vS dS tai nhanh chong va chinh xac T~o m()t qui trinh dang kY thgc hi~n dS tai m()t each hgp ly nhfun tranh cac tru(mg hqp chep ho~c trimg l~p thgc hi~n Phl,lC V\1 cong tac thfmg ke, tAng hgp nh~m nang cao chftt lugng giang d~y cua giao vien Qufm ly dS titi t6t nghi~p Trang TruiYng Dq.i hQc Kinh d TP.HCM 2002 D~ tainghien czm khoa h()c II NQI DUNGNGHIEN CUu: Tim hiSu thvc tr~g cong tac quanly d@ Uti nghien Clru caccApdao t~o nganh Quan tri kinh doanh t~i Khoa Quan tri kinh doanh TB chuc mo hinh luu trU thongtin phvc V\1 cong tac tim kiem, tra Clru thongtin du li~U ve detai tbt nghi~p Xay d\fllg ph fin mem (rng d\lng quanly tren Web thong qua h~ th6ng Intranet cua truemg Website: http:/1172.18.3.12/qlluanvan/ '2 Phon qua n ~,login Qmin ly d~ tai t6t nghi~p user name: quanly, password: 12345 Trang Tru&ng Dc;ti h9c Kinh ti TP.HCM 2002 Di tainghien cu-u khoa h9c Phfull: THUCTRANGCONGTAC • • ? , ~ ' z - , 1: QUANLYDE TAl TOT NGHI~P CACCAPDAOTAO NGANH TAl • • KHOA QUAN TRJ KINH DOANH Qmin ly dB tai t6t nghi~p Trang DJ tainghiencUu khoa hrc Truong Dgi hrc Kinh fi TP.HCM 2002 sqlDelete ="Delete from t_giaovien where magv="' & Trim(oRs("magv")) & ""' conn.Execute(sqlDelete) Intmaso = "" sql2 = Request.form("sql2") set oRs = server.createobject("ADODB.recordset") oRs.Open sql2, conn, 3, Set Session("oRs") = oRs End If Else Iflntmaso "" Then sql1 = Request.QueryString("sql") IflnStr(sqll,"ORDER") Then sqll = Left(sqll,InStr(sqll,"ORDER")-1) End If Count= request.Querystring("Count") - l strQuery = "Select * from t_giaovien where magv='" & intmaso & "'" Set oRs = server.createobject("ADODB.recordset") oRs.Open strQuery, conn, 3, Set Session("oRs") = oRs Else Intmaso = Trim(Request.QueryString("maso")) strQuery = "select * from t_giaovien order by ten asc" 'strQuerydt = "select * from t hedaotao" Set oRs = server.createobject("ADODB.recordset") oRs.Open strQuery, conn, 3, Set Session("oRs") = oRs End If End If Stored Procedure updategv: CREATE PROCEDURE updategv @tengv char(SO), @bomon char(10), @chucdanh char(30), @dienthoai char(20), @email char(30), @intmaso smallint AS Declare @Hoten char(SO), @Holot char( SO), @Ten char(30), @vitri smallint Select @HoTen=Reverse(LTRIM(RTRIM(@tengv))) Select @vitri=charindex(space( 1),@Hoten) Select @Ten= reverse(substring(@HoTen,1,@vitri-1)) Select @Holot = reverse(LTRIM(RTRIM(stuff(@Hoten,1,@vitri,NULL)))) update dbo.t_giaovien set ho=@Holot, ten=@Ten, bomon=@bomon,chucdanh=@Chucdanh,dienthoai=@dienthoai,email=@email where magv=@intmaso Qmin ly d8 tai t6t nghi~p Trang 65 Truc!ng Dt;zi h9c Kinh ti TP.HCM 2002 ' DJ tainghiencuu khoa h9c 4.2.3 Trang hiSn thi thongtin chinh sua v@ Dan vi thuc tap, he dao , tao, nganh, 16p: !I Quim IV luan an tOt nghli!p - Microsoft Internet EKploret ·~? .r:: ~ DI~U CHiNH TEN DO'N VI THU'C TAP Nh~p l~i thongtin va nh~n nut c~p nh~t, ho~c ·nh§n ~ut x6~ x6a bod~ x6a Ma dvtt: Ten ElVTT: Elia chi: Lo~i hlnh ON : 14 lr::G:-:-iay-:YI:.-N:::-H7":"H~U::;rE I -I I qp nh~t J · X6a b6 Tro v~ !rang tnroc Phfut c~p nh~t va x6a cua cac trang tuang tv nen chfulg toi xin gi6i thi~u phfut c~p nh~t, xoa cua trang dan vi thgc t~p Cac trang dugc thi~t k~ b~ng ASP va sir dl)ng cau l~nh SQL dS thgc thi trvc ti~p tren CSDL Sau day Ia do~n code ASP: If IsObject(Session("qlluanvan_conn")) Then Set conn= Session("qlluanvan_conn") Else Set conn= Server.CreateObject("ADODB.Connection") conn.open "qlluanvan","user","password" Set Session("qlluanvan_conn") =conn End If Intmaso = Trim(Request.QueryString("maso")) sqll = Request.QueryString("sql") sql ="select* from t_donvitt order by tendvtt asc" Qmin ly d~ tai t6t nghi~p Trang 66 Tru&ng D(;li h(Jc Kinh fi TP.HCM 2002 D€ tcli nghiencuu khoa h(Jc If request.Fonn("update") "" Or request.Form("delete") "" Then If request.Form("update") 1111 Then Intmaso = Request.Fonn("Intmaso") MasoiD = Trim(Request.fonn("MasoiDnum")) tendvtt = Request.Fonn("tendvtt") diachi=Request.Fonn("diachi") lhdn=Request.Fonn("lhdn ") set oRshedt = Server.CreateObject("ADODB.recordset") sqlUpdate ="Update t_donvitt Set tendvtt=N" & tendvtt & " 1, diachi=N" & diachi & "', lhdn=1" & lhdn & " where madvtt=" & Intmaso & "" conn.Execute( sqlUpdate) set oRs = server.createobject("ADODB.recordset") sql2 = Request.form("sql2") oRs.Open sql2, conn, 3, Set Session("oRs") = oRs Intmaso="" Response.Write sql2 Else Set oRs = Session("oRs") MasoiD = Request.form("MasoiDnum") sqlDelete ="Delete from t_donvitt where madvtt=" & Trim(oRs("madvtt")) & ""' conn.Execute(sqlDelete) Intmaso = "" sql2 = Request.form("sql2") set oRs = server.createobject("ADODB.recordset") oRs.Open sq12, conn, 3, Set Session("oRs") = oRs End If 4.3 Trang tim ki~m thongtin Juan an: Trang tuong tv trang tra CUuthongtin phdn phvc V\1 nguai sir dvng 4.4 Upload file: Phdn upload file se duqc cai d~t va kich ho~t phdn nh~p thongtin v@ d@ tai (n~u c6), file duqc chQn (browser) se duqc tv d